Addressing Agricultural Innovation in North Dakota

North Dakota's agricultural landscape poses distinctive challenges, particularly in rural areas where farmers struggle to adopt new technologies. With around 90% of the state being rural and agriculture representing a substantial part of the economy, there's a pressing need for increased productivity and sustainability. For farmers facing climate variability and labor shortages, the establishment of agri-tech innovation hubs can provide critical support. These hubs will serve as knowledge centers where local farmers can access advanced agricultural techniques and technology.

Who Benefits from Agri-Tech Innovation Hubs in North Dakota

Local farmers, particularly in the state's rural regions, are the primary beneficiaries of the agri-tech innovation hubs. With North Dakota being home to nearly 30,000 farms, this initiative targets those who are eager to enhance their operational efficiency but may lack the requisite knowledge or resources. Additionally, agri-business enterprises can also participate, benefiting from partnerships that foster innovation tailored to local agricultural practices and challenges.
